What is your own make certain?

It is an appropriate pledge created by just one, toward lender, in respect away from a loan or facility being pulled by business entity (age.g. a friends otherwise relationship). In return for the financial institution giving the borrowed funds, the individual pledges its individual assets because the a warranty if the business standard on the repayments. Or else breach new regards to its mortgage contract. Around most promises, the newest guarantor effortlessly acts as dominant debtor. Which means the lending company opinions the brand new guarantor since if it were an event to your original loan itself and and therefore in control to have complying having its terms. It be sure lets the lending company in order to efficiently dominate of guarantors’ individual possessions. Attempting to sell her or him out of so you can pay off the loan will be the organization neglect to meets their obligations. A personal make certain are hence a very effective and you will of good use file off an excellent lenders’ direction.

Think about directors’ guarantees?

In law, included companies are regarded as independent courtroom organizations/characters. This means he’s considered as are separate on the people that run and own the organization by itself. Whenever a family can be applied for a financial loan, the firm in itself was accountable for its very own personal debt, not the new directors otherwise investors.

When the a company falls towards the difficulties with and then make their payments, or gets insolvent, the lending company may have difficulty for the implementing the terminology contrary to the organization in an effort to get well its currency. So you’re able to maximum this exposure loan providers can sometimes ask the new administrators so you’re able to ensure the organizations costs. This can together with affect limited-liability partnerships.

The fresh directors’ private property (elizabeth.g. family home, features, discounts, cash) is effectively on the line if the providers default towards its financing agreement.

What can i look out for?

Private pledges, as the a common density in the commercial financing, are usually regarded as a distressing inclusion towards process. Given that guarantor may initial don’t see the benefits. However, certain legal counsel shall be offered therefore the guarantor totally understands their effects. Particular as an alternative onerous words can occasionally include:

  • A lack of power to discuss or vary any terms of the borrowed funds agreement (elizabeth.g. cost terminology).
  • The fresh new make certain is almost certainly not restricted to simply the first loan. It can be drawn up such because ways concerning are any loan otherwise personal debt of your organization, if or not today or even in the future, you may possibly or may not have expertise in. Speaking of called “every monies” promises.
  • Or no of your own possessions happen to be subject to an excellent costs by a preexisting lender, might often be necessary to score consent regarding the independent lender prior to proceeding. Yet another Action regarding Top priority are frequently expected. That is an appropriate file you to sets out and therefore bank becomes exactly what first-in case that property need to be caught to settle one loans.
  • Almost always there is a term from the financing arrangement meaning that the lending company can “call-in” the loan on the demand. The lender can effortlessly consult cost when, and therefore in case your company is struggling to pay off, it may look into guarantor as an easy way of repayment.
  • If the loan is paid very early, will set you back and you can interest is owed which have been perhaps not taken into account.

Private guarantees can sometimes believe that, where there is certainly several guarantor toward loan, each one of the individuals guarantors are “jointly and you may severally” accountable. Thus https://tennesseetitleloans.org/cities/nashville/ the lender normally effectively do it against both of your own guarantors. Or, if this favors, facing one to guarantor simply.

Security

Loan providers will either require a charge getting put-on particular assets pledged because of the guarantor (e.grams. house otherwise financial support features). In such cases, the lending company commonly secure their attention about property of the registering a fee against the identity. This can prevent the guarantor regarding disposing of the house or property versus this new consent of your bank.

In case your home is currently billed significantly less than a preexisting home loan, you will be compelled to search this new consent of one’s established mortgage lender and further paperwork are required.

Furthermore, if for example the resource are co-possessed with a third party (we.elizabeth. partner or loved one), the bank could possibly get query the third-party to include a separate verify, while they could have no interest in the firm.

Indemnities

Indemnities are included included in the make certain and certainly will lay an increased responsibility towards guarantor. Generally speaking, the sum of protected ought not to meet or exceed the level of the organization loan. Although not, an enthusiastic indemnity term brings a unique responsibility owed by the guarantor with the lender. That possibly apply following the mortgage has been paid down.

This should essentially behave as follows:

  • The organization non-payments towards the their financial obligation within the financing arrangement;
  • The financial institution endures a loss of profits because of the breach because of the providers;
  • The financial institution normally believe in the indemnity provided by the fresh new guarantor to invest right back one losses.

Including, an indemnity condition would be used. This would stretch liability for the guarantor the spot where the lender means to recover its judge will set you back in getting people violation from the business, from process of law or otherwise.
